Lahore Railway Station
20x22 ins, acrylic on Yupo. August 7, 2015. August 14 and 15 mark the anniversaries of the 1947 partition of India and the creation of Pakistan. As those dates draw near, I can't help but reminisce. We lived across from this historic railway station built by the British in 1860, where many of the atrocities took place and tens of thousands were massacred. Usually teeming with humanity now, I left the beautiful structure derelict for you to fill in the empty spaces. If those walls could just talk.......
